## Deployment: Autocomplete Index

The Quillfern suggestion service rebuilds its autocomplete index during every deploy, and on larger tenants this rebuild can take upwards of twenty minutes. Do not promote the release until the index warmer reports a ready state in the Lanternwood dashboard; promoting early serves stale suggestions and triggers timeout alerts. If the rebuild stalls, restart only the indexer pod, never the query tier. Before initiating the rollout, confirm the staging values match the settings below.

service settings:
[casax]
port = 6379
team = rusir
host = casax.zemvarhq.corp
region = outer-4
access_code = ac_9808ce
timeout_ms = 1500

# Weekly Cash-Box Run

Every Friday morning, the petty-cash box from the Millbrent office heads over to the central counting room at Harrowgate House. It's a small grey strongbox, sealed with a numbered tag, and it always travels with the regular courier on the 10:15 loop. Dispatch logs the tag number before it leaves and the counting room confirms on arrival. Nothing fancy, just keep it consistent. When the courier shows up, relay this instruction verbatim:

courier memo of bawig-kahap: the casath ralmir courier leaves the norok weniel norok druvan frador ulaiel belix druael ledger at gate 3981 under passcode 761393

Item 14: Verify the donation-receipt mailer for the Lanternwood Trust sends exactly one receipt per completed gift, including the correct tax-year line. Check the suppression list is applied before each batch and that bounced addresses are flagged within 48 hours. Sample at least ten receipts per quarter. Any discrepancies must be reported to the responsible party below.

named custodian: Rusion Joreth Holvan Norwyn

## Runbook: Dark-mode rollout, Emberlight admin dashboard

Dark-mode support ships behind the `theme.dusk` flag. Reviewers should confirm the palette tokens load from the Huecrest theming service rather than hardcoded values, and that contrast checks pass in the CI visual suite. Toggling the flag requires no redeploy; the dashboard polls Huecrest every five minutes. The polling client authenticates to Huecrest with the internal key below.

gateway credential: kto23_LX9A4ys6i4nzHtpOLNLodKK